The Role of Zero-Knowledge Proofs in Compliance

Imagine you’re at a local farmer’s market where you want to buy vegetables, but you don’t want to disclose your entire grocery list. Zero-knowledge proofs allow you to verify your ability to buy certain items without revealing everything. Similarly, in DeFi, these proofs can help users confirm compliance with the HIBT guidelines while maintaining privacy.
